Data from: (if we've garbled it, blame us not them)

Homefield Credit Union

This record is in the data pool of...
  • NCUA
Meet the neighbors:

Address
Physical Address
138 S Main St
Milford, MA 01757-3272
United States
Mailing Address
138 South Main Street
Milford, MA 01757
United States
Phone
5088395493

Other Locations

Address
86 Worcester St
North Grafton, MA 01536-1020
United States

Editors of this entry

There is no current editor for this entry. Would you like to become the editor for this entry?

Edit |